Elizabeth Vosseller, Executive Director of I-ASC and founder of Spelling to Communicate (S2C), proudly calls autism-friendly Herndon, VA, her hometown. Since 1995, she’s supported individuals with complex communication and sensory-motor needs across hospital, university, and private practice settings. In 2013, she began teaching purposeful motor skills to help students spell to communicate—redefining access to education and inclusion for nonspeakers.
“26 letters equals infinite possibilities!”
Now, through I-ASC, Elizabeth is dedicated to ensuring all nonspeaking individuals have access to communication via training, advocacy, education, and research.
